When asked, most parents say they have talked about vaccines with their child’s regular doctor in the past two years, most often discussing vaccines needed for school (82%).
And less often about flu shots (68%) or COVID-19 vaccination options (57%).
Fifteen percent of parents responded to a recent C.S. Mott Children’s Hospital National Poll published on November 21, 2022, saying they did not discuss vaccines with their child’s regular doctor.
Unfortunately, 6% of parents reported that their child does not get any vaccines.
